The Nokia Morph
A concept phone, designed by Nokia‘s Research Center together with the Cambridge Nanoscience Center (UK) and completely based on Nanotechnology. It will take at lease 7 years before Nokia thinks that the Morph will hit the market, but it looks promising.

From iPhone to Morph in 7 years
The iPhone is the design of today. The word ‘phone’ would be an understatement for the Morph. The Morph, like the name suggests, can take on many shapes and forms. It can be used as a phone, headset, watch, e-reader, camera and PDA. And possibly even more.

Nanotechnology
Nanotechnology and microfibers will make a design like the Morph possible in the future. Another advantage of the usage of microfibers is that it enables the Morph to charge itself simply by being exposed to sunlight. But that’s not all, the Morph will be able to monitor its surroundings. For instance, it can monitor body temperature and vital signs, predict the weather and possibly more. And last but not least, the phone is fully biodegradable and ecologically friendly. All we can do is sit back and wait.
